Boeroer Posted October 13, 2020 Share Posted October 13, 2020 correct You still can - if you crit a lot. That can be done by debuffing Reflex first (e.g. with Miasma of Dull-Mindedness from a Wizard and a Nature's Mark from Druid for -30 Reflex). 1 Deadfire Community Patch: Nexus Mods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
